New Jersey didn't see any Powerball jackpot winners — lucky ticket-holders from California, Florida and Tennessee will split Wednesday night's world-record-setting prize — but it is home to two new millionaires.

Two New Jersey Lottery ticket-holders won the second prize, matching 5 white balls, making those tickets worth $1,000,000 each. One of those ticket-holders added the Powerplay multiplier, making that ticket worth $2,000,000, according to the New Jersey Lottery.

In addition, there were 46 third-prizewinners with tickets that matched 4 white balls.

The winning numbers for the Wednesday, Jan. 13 drawing were: 04, 08, 19, 27 and 34. The Red Power Ball number was 10. The Multiplier number was 02.

Where were the winning tickets sold?

• The $2,000,000 second-prizewinning ticket was purchased at WAWA No. 423, 76 Springside Road, Westampton in Burlington County.

• The $1,000,000 second-prizewinning ticket was purchased at 7-Eleven No. 15560 (G), 171 Buckelew Ave., Jamesburg in Middlesex County.

The 46 third-prizewinning ticketholders matched the 4 white balls and the Powerball making their tickets worth $50,000. Three of those tickets were purchased with the Powerplay multiplier, making their tickets worth $100,000 each.

Another 1,135,393 New Jersey players took home an estimated $5,487,162 in prizes ranging from $4 to $200, according to the New Jersey Lottery.

The Powerball jackpot will reset to $40,000,000 for the next drawing to be held Saturday, Jan. 16 at 10:59 pm.
